What is dairy-free Ben and Jerry’s made of?

Ben and Jerry’s dairy-free ice cream line is made with an almond milk base instead of cow’s milk. The almond milk provides the creamy texture without the dairy. Ben and Jerry’s sources almonds that are grown sustainably to produce the almond milk for their dairy-free flavors.

What are the main ingredients in dairy-free Ben and Jerry’s?

The primary ingredients in Ben and Jerry’s dairy-free ice cream flavors are:

  • Almond milk – Provides the creamy, ice cream-like texture
  • Sugar – Sweetens the ice cream
  • Cocoa/Chocolate – Used in chocolate flavors
  • Natural flavors – Provide the signature Ben and Jerry’s flavor
  • Guar gum – A plant-based thickener that gives body and texture
  • Locust bean gum – Another plant-based thickener
  • Vegetable glycerin – Helps make the ice cream smooth and creamy

The almond milk gives the ice cream a rich, creamy mouthfeel similar to dairy ice cream. Sugar adds sweetness to balance the almond flavor. Cocoa or chocolate provide signature chocolatey flavors when used. Natural flavors like vanilla extract infuse Ben and Jerry’s classic flavor profiles. The gums and vegetable glycerin give the ice cream its smooth, creamy consistency.

Does dairy-free Ben and Jerry’s contain lactose or cow’s milk?

No, Ben and Jerry’s dairy-free ice creams are 100% lactose- and cow’s milk-free. They do not contain any dairy ingredients at all. The almond milk base has no traces of lactose, cow’s milk proteins, or cow’s milk fat. This makes Ben and Jerry’s dairy-free flavors safe for those with lactose intolerance or milk allergies.

What are some popular dairy-free Ben and Jerry’s flavors?

Some of Ben and Jerry’s most popular dairy-free flavors include:

Flavor Name Description
Non-Dairy Chunky Monkey Banana ice cream with fudge chunks and walnuts
Non-Dairy Chocolate Fudge Brownie Chocolate ice cream with fudge brownies
Non-Dairy Cherry Garcia Cherry ice cream with cherries & dark chocolate chunks
Non-Dairy Coconut Seven Layer Bar Graham cracker ice cream with coconut, fudge, & caramel swirls
Non-Dairy Coffee Caramel Fudge Coffee ice cream with salted caramel swirls & fudge chips

These flavors take Ben and Jerry’s iconic ice cream tastes and transform them into dairy-free, plant-based indulgences. They seek to recreate the core experience of flavors like Cherry Garcia and Chunky Monkey without any dairy ingredients whatsoever.
